90+ | View from the Cellar | The new release of the Cygnus “Albireo” Cava Reserva Brut is made from a blend of forty- five percent Macabeu (forty-nine year-old vines), thirty-five percent Xarel-lo and twenty percent Parellada, with all of the grapes grown organically. The wine was aged fifteen months in its fine lees prior to disgorgement in July of 2022. The wine offers up a refined bouquet of lemon, tart pear, wild fennel, salty white soil tones and a topnote of lemongrass. On the palate the wine is crisp, precise and full-bodied, with a good core, excellent mineral undertow, frothy mousse and lovely length and grip on the impeccably balanced finish. I do not know what the dosage is for this bottling, but it seems quite low and perfectly suited to the wine. A lovely bottle. 2023-2040. John Gilman - Issue #103 January/February 2023. |

90 | Wine Enthusiast | Aromas of lemon curd, orange blossom and croissant set the scene for flavors of pineapple, lemon-lime sorbet, marzipan and rose water. This wine is lightly effervescent on the tongue and has a bright lemon zest finish. M.D. - November, 2022 |
